- The distance between Hermit, Co, Usa and Bayan-Ovoo, Mongolia is approximately 9,720 km or 6,040 mi.
- To reach Hermit, Co in this distance one would set out from Bayan-Ovoo bearing 29.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Hermit, Co bearing 154.9° or SSE .
- Hermit, Co has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Bayan-Ovoo has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with dry winters (Dwb).
- Both are in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1.1 °C (1.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.1 °C (25.4°F) less in Hermit, Co.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 131.2 mm (5.2 in) more which is equivalent to 131.2 l/m² (3.22 US gal/ft²) or 1,312,000 l/ha (140,262 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.8° higher in Hermit, Co than in Bayan-Ovoo.
